410779127261 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 410779127262. Its totient is φ = 410779127260.

The previous prime is 410779127203. The next prime is 410779127347. The reversal of 410779127261 is 162721977014.

It is a happy number.

It is a weak pr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 231066721636 + 179712405625 = 480694^2 + 423925^2 .

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 410779127261 - 234 = 393599258077 is a prime.

It is a Sophie Germain prime.

It is a Curzon number.

It is a congruent number.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(410779127461)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 205389563630 + 205389563631.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(205389563631).

Almost surely, 2410779127261 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

410779127261 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

410779127261 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

410779127261 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 296352, while the sum is 47.

The spelling of 410779127261 in words is "four hundred ten billion, seven hundred seventy-nine million, one hundred twenty-seven thousand, two hundred sixty-one".
